đź§µ What is Smocked Fabric

Smocked Fabric is created using a controlled gathering technique (smocking) that produces a stretchy, pleated, and textured surface. The fabric naturally expands and contracts, making it both functional and decorative.

It is commonly made using stretch knit bases such as spandex blends, polyester knits, or lightweight woven stretch fabrics.

âť“ Frequently Asked Questions

What is Smocked Fabric used for?

Smocked Fabric is used for fashion garments that require stretch, texture, and a fitted silhouette such as dresses, tops, and skirts.

Is Smocked Fabric stretchy?

Yes. Smocked Fabric has built-in elasticity due to its gathered construction, allowing it to expand comfortably with movement.

What makes Smocked Fabric different?

Unlike standard stretch fabrics, Smocked Fabric has a textured, gathered surface that adds both design detail and functional stretch.

Can Smocked Fabric be used for dresses?

Yes. It is one of the most popular uses due to its fitted yet flexible structure.
